O'Gara leads Lions

Mon 22 Jun, 01:00 PM


Ireland fly-half Ronan O'Gara will captain the British and Irish Lions in Tuesday night's clash against the Emerging Springboks at Newlands.

O'Gara becomes the fifth different skipper on tour, following Paul O'Connell, Brian O'Driscoll, Phil Vickery and Donncha O'Callaghan.

Grand Slam winner O'Gara leads a side that contains six players who were involved in Saturday's 26-21 first Test defeat against world champions South Africa.

Test substitutes O'Callaghan and Martyn Williams both start, while Test line-up members Ugo Monye, Lee Mears, Phil Vickery and David Wallace are on the bench.

The side includes props Tim Payne and John Hayes, who were only recently summoned to join the tour party.

England international Payne has flown out as cover for Andrew Sheridan, who has a back strain, while Hayes replaces ankle injury victim Euan Murray.
